The diary entry summarizes key events in Achilles' backstory based on Greek mythology. It discusses how his mother Thetis dipped him in the river Styx to make him immortal everywhere except his heel. It then outlines Achilles being sent in disguise to the island of Skyros to avoid fighting in the Trojan War. The entry notes that Odysseus was sent to recruit Achilles and persuade him to join the war, which he did with 50 ships and his army. It questions whether Achilles had a falling out with Agamemnon over a woman, which caused him to withdraw from battle for a time and weakened the Greeks.
